If you have a lot of product
photos, I would not handle this one by one inside the Shopify
admin.
The workflow I usually
recommend is:
Export or collect the
original product photos in one
folder
Remove the backgrounds in
batch
Save transparent PNG
versions
Export a second set with a
clean white or light background
for Shopify / marketplace use
Upload the finished images
back to Shopify
For small numbers of images,
remove.bg, Canva, or Photoshop
are fine. For larger catalogs,
batch processing matters much
more than the background
removal model itself.

If your issue is a theme
background color or grey
wrapper around already-
transparent PNGs, then the fix
is probably CSS instead. But if
the background is baked into
the image file, you need to
process the images before
uploading.
Shopify has a built in “remove background” button per image, but it is one at a time, not bulk.
For bulk, apps like Pixc, PhotoRoom, or Removal.AI work well and are priced per image.
You could also batch edit outside Shopify first, like with remove.bg then upload after.
